This exceptional antique apothecary cabinet/card index cabinet likely originates from Europe and dates back to the early 20th century. Crafted from solid wood—probably pine—and complemented by original metal fittings, this piece embodies the functional elegance of historical office furniture.
The numerous small, evenly spaced drawers point to its original use:
Such cabinets were traditionally used in pharmacies for storing herbs and substances, as well as in libraries and offices for archiving index cards.
